Product Description
CAY10575 is an inhibitor of IKK-ε. IKK-ε is a homolog of IKK-α and IKK-β which can activate NF-κB. NF-κB is activated upon degradation of IκB following IKK-α and IKK-β phosphorylation. CAY10575 is a benzimidazole analog that inhibits IKK-ε with an IC₅₀ value of ~15.8 µM.
